(Chantal Mouffe, 2013) Diffuse fears of strangers as well as xenophobia, Islamophobia, and anti-Semitism are among the challenges facing Europe. What is causing this new fundamentalism? How can increasing rightwing populism and racism in Europe be curtailed and overcome? What possibilities exist for living together peacefully? How can immigration policy be improved? How do we want to live together in the future? And what role does art have to play in coping with the crisis?
DISCOURSES, a lecture series hosted by the Akademie der Künste and the Bundeszentrale für politische Bildung (Federal Agency for Civic Education) is dedicated to these and other current questions. In 12 lectures, writers, commentators and prominent representatives of migration studies, political science, sociology, philosophy, and art scholarship will pose questions about Europe’s past and future, and try to develop new points of view – with Michael Lüders, Rita Süssmuth, Claus Leggewie, Armin Nassehi, Grada Kilomba and Chantal Mouffe, et al. Each lecture will be accompanied and commented on by the young team from Polis180, the grassroots think tank for foreign and European policy. The emerging international scholars will challenge the established experts with critical questions in order to stimulate a dynamic exchange of perspectives.
